Transaction 8602be229146ca320f154c59a98f49640818eb49a418b66e22f5329235bdff85
1 Input
1 Output
-
8602be229146ca320f154c59a98f49640818eb49a418b66e22f5329235bdff85:0
- value
- 98527
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2b09d3ce3f698ee96349eea776af9c599d9b236a OP_EQUAL
- address
- 35cakcKf77MBemJe55cj27feXrtRizeXYa